3. Pluralism
policy is influenced by the power of special interests that dominate particular areas.
3. Elitism
policy is controlled by a small number of well-positioned, highly influential individuals.
3. Majoritarianism
policy is determined by the numerical majority.

What are the three main social insurance programs?
Social Security. Unemployment Insurance. Medicare.
What is the IMF? Function?
International Monetary Fund = makes short term loans to countries experiencing temporary problems from collapsing economically.
World Bank function?
makes long-term development loans to poor countries for capital investment projects such as dams, highways, and factories.
Three principle economic goals of U.S.?
1. Access to energy and other natural resources. 2. Stable and open system of trade. 3. Prevent gap btwn rich and poor countries from destabilizing world economy.
Why was Eisenhower concerned about military industrial complex?
1. military industries would exert influence on government policy. 2. individual companies might influence military strategy by their advocacy of their weapon systems. 3. Conglomerate of military industrial power might threaten individual liberty.
What three factors make the U.S. tax system relatively unprogressive?
1. Top tax rate not high compared to E.U. 2. Many tax deductions for upper-income individuals. 3. Social security = flat tax rate for people earning less than $95,000.
Distinguish between positive and negative government
negative = government stays out of lives and gives people freedom to determine their own pursuits. positive = government intervenes to enhance personal liberty and security when economic and social are out of their control.
6 major power centers
U.S., E.U., Japan, China, Russia, Multinational corporations.
Comparative advantage?
Logic that one country may produce a particular good at a lower opportunity cost than another person or country. Trade creates gain for both parties because it is more efficient for a country to invest all their resources to one product.
Idea of transfer payment. Who is main recepient?
A government benefit that is given directly to an individual. Social security to retiree.
earned income tax credit
tax credit for certain people who work and have low wages that reduces the amount of tax you owe. can be a refund.
